  • 1. Accounting policies

    Basis of measurement and preparation

    These financial statements have been prepared in accordance with the provisions of Section 1A (Small Entities) of Financial Reporting Standard 102

    Tangible fixed assets depreciation policy

    All property, plant and equipment (PPE) is stated at historical cost less depreciation. Cost of an item of PPE includes both its purchase price and any directly attributable costs that were required for the asset to be prepared and made available for operational use. Depreciation, based on a component approach, is calculated using the straight-line method to allocate the cost over the assets estimated useful lives, as follows: '- Plant and machinery: 10% annually on cost

    Other accounting policies

    Income and expenses are recognised in these financial statements on an accruals basis. Foreign currency - The financial statements have been prepared in GBP, the reporting currency of the Company. Assets and liabilities in foreign currencies are translated into GBP at the rate of exchange ruling at the balance sheet date whilst transactions in foreign currencies are translated into GBP at the rate of exchange ruling at the date of the transaction with any gains or losses on currency exchange recognised in the profit and loss account. Taxation - Taxation for the year comprises current and deferred tax. Tax is recognised in the profit and loss account where applicable, although current or deferred taxation assets and liabilities are not discounted. Current tax is recognised at the amount of tax payable using the tax rates and laws that have been enacted or substantively enacted by the balance sheet date.
